Naoe Okamura is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Cognitive Neuroscience and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Naoe Okamura has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 2.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, 11 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 9 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Naoe Okamura’s work include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(10 papers), Sleep and Wakefulness Research (8 papers) and Nerve injury and regeneration (5 papers). Naoe Okamura is often cited by papers focused on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(10 papers), Sleep and Wakefulness Research (8 papers) and Nerve injury and regeneration (5 papers). Naoe Okamura coll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Germany. Naoe Okamura's co-authors include Kenji Hashimoto, Masaomi Iyo, Eiji Shimizu, Rainer K. Reinscheid, Kaori Koike, Naoya Komatsu, Michiko Nakazato, Chikara Kumakiri, Naoyuki Shinoda and Hiroyuki Watanabe and has published in prestigious journals such as Neuron, Biological Psychiatry and Brain Research.
